Harper POV:

That evening, Bennet dragged me to "The Red Wolf," the pack's most exclusive restaurant. He wanted to parade his "recovering" wife.

I wore black. I felt like I was attending a wake.

Mid-appetizer, Bennet's phone rang. He hit speaker by accident.

"Alpha! Help me!"

Gianna's voice shrieked. The restaurant went silent.

"Rogues! They have me! They said... Harper paid them!"

Bennet froze. His eyes turned pitch black.

"Where are you?" he barked.

"The old mill! They have silver!"

The line went dead.

Bennet looked at me. The air charged with ozone and rage. His aura exploded outward, rattling the plates.

"You," he snarled. "You hired Rogues?"

"No," I gasped, the pressure crushing my lungs. "Bennet, think. I have no money. I have no contacts..."

"Don't lie to me!" He flipped the heavy oak table. Glass shattered. He grabbed me by the throat, lifting me off my feet.

"I knew you were jealous," he hissed. "But I didn't think you were a monster."

My feet dangled. I clawed at his hand.

"It's... a trap..." I choked.

He dropped me. I fell into the broken china, gasping.

"I'm getting her back," he announced to the room. "And when I return, you will wish you were dead."

He stormed out.

I scrambled up. The pack members looked at me with disgust. To them, I was the jealous, crippled Luna who put a hit on the mistress.

I ran. Not to the car, but into the night.

I reached the edge of town. My phone buzzed.

Application Update: Rogue Status Approved. Effective Immediately.

I was free. Legally.

But as I stepped into the shadows, a cloth pressed over my mouth.

Chloroform. And Wolfsbane.

"Got her," a rough voice grunted. "Alpha pays double for live cargo."
